Transaction 23885f64b522ae3c22604bfd12306947ef31fdacddbbba2110ceed204fc7c328
1 Input
1 Output
-
23885f64b522ae3c22604bfd12306947ef31fdacddbbba2110ceed204fc7c328:0
- value
- 487472
- script pubkey
- OP_0 OP_PUSHBYTES_20 8fb952c66a7f6117b02728338a48257e7f41e6cc
- address
- bc1q37u493n20as30vp89qec5jp90el5rekvl063hv